NNU: Annantram Faults Pre-Election Process To Pick New Leaders
By Daniel Dafe, Abraka
Dr. Ossai Sylvanus ANNANTRAM, Publicity Secretary, OGAIN ISU NDOKWA has faulted the pre-election process to pick new executive members for Ndokwa Neku Union (NNU).
An open letter written to Chief Nze Ananyi,
Chairman, NNU Electoral Committee, said that there was a breach of electoral guidelines in the clearance for aspirants to contest the election.
Annantram added: “You have cleared persons who are party officers and political appointee to contest the election AGAINST the electoral guidelines.”
Continuing, he said: “You have cleared persons who are not holders of degree as required by the guidelines.
“You have cleared persons that their nomination forms were not properly completed in line with NNU ELECTORAL GUIDELINES.”

Furthermore, he said that the delegate list ought to be made available 3 days to the NNU General Election.
“This Election is sure to lack confidence of the good people of Ndokwa Nation and most likely a new NNU shall emerge to fight for Ndokwa Nation Development AGENDA,” he added.
He called on Ananyi to find time to review all the breaches he pinpointed to save his name as NNU
Electoral Committee Chairman and former NNU President General aspirant who discredited the process in 2014.
